I plan to stream video from my Pogoplug Video sitting at home, to my PC at my place of work. This involves streaming personal video content to my work PC sitting behind the company firewall and using the company browser.

If I open www.mypogoplug.com using the company browser and start streaming video this way, am I using the company's computing resource,s to the point that the IT police will notice what I am doing and warn me not to use company computing resources for personal use? My understanding with the latest cloud technology is that the computing resources are provided by the source cloud (my home-based Pogoplug Video) and that by streaming video to my workplace, I am only using the company browser as a window and I am not costing the company dollars in terms of bandwith utilization.

I am IT-challenged and would appreciate an explanation as to whether or not I should even worry about my company finding out that I am streaming video to my workdesk through the company browser. Everyone here is allowed to stream unlimited video from YouTube, Facebook, Twitter, etc. so why can't I stream video from my own cloud, i.e. my beloved Pogoplug video?

Anything that you do on the internet (web browsing, email, instant messaging, etc.) utilizes bandwidth, no matter the source. Streaming audio and video from you pogoplug is pretty much the same as streaming from youtube or other such sites. Your IT guys will know. I wonder if they'll really care.
